A lot of the old impeller type dishwashers had the plates in a circle to face the spray head-on. I had an American Kitchens machine years ago with a rotating upper rack as well. It was amazing how fast that rack would spin from the force of the impeller, even full of glasses and mugs!

It will be interesting to see a bit more of this dishwasher - being GEC one would expect some sort of British connection but its not like anything I have seen before. GEC did have a dishwasher in the early 1960s but it was top loading and looked like a GE MobileMaid
